The most in-depth, comprehensive book of common idioms and phraseology available From proverbial expressions ("the best things in life are free") to idiomatic expressions ("the best of both worlds") to the all-too-familiar clichés ("the best-case scenario"), idioms are not only embedded in our language, but they are also a colorful reflection of our American culture. McGraw-Hill's Dictionary of American Idioms embraces the fullest breadth of these idioms in one comprehensive reference that is a must-have for both ESL learners and native speakers. Providing the most comprehensive treatment of American phraseology available, particularly in the area of verbal expressions, McGraw-Hill's Dictionary of American Idioms features: More than 24,000 entries Concise definitions of each entry and sense, followed by one or two example sentences Idiomatic phrases, proverbial expressions, and cliches Guidance on the tone appropriate for a select phrase as well as its origin Thorough treatment of variation, of particular help to ESL learners A comprehensive Phrase-Finder Index
